Weblines show the edge of an object, the intersection of surfaces that form corners, edges, and the extent of a curved surface, such as the sides of a cylinder. Hidden lines show the same features as object lines EXCEPT that the corners, edges, and curved surfaces cannot be seen because they are hidden behind the surface of the object. WebA hidden line, also known as a hidden object line is a medium weight line, made of short dashes about 1/8” long with 1/16”gaps, to show edges, surfaces and corners which …

WebMar 29, 2024 · Hidden Lines (Thin) type lines consist of thin short dashes, closely and evenly spaced. These lines are drawn to represent hidden or invisible edges of the objects.
